I'm not familiar with the Portal object.  I looked at the 4.18 version and it doesn't have much of an example.  It seems you are doing what it says, initially, which is to create the Portal object, setup the query params and then run the query.  Not sure where the map is getting set (if at all) in that example.  In your code, after you create the Portal object and then set the query params and run the query, you then set up the Map and MapView.  Nowhere do I see the creation of a Featurelayer or other object that you can add to the Map to create a layer.  If the portal id that you obfuscated is supposed to be a Map with a Layer in it then I don't see a need to then create the Map and MapView.  

Not sure if I can help you here, but to my previous points, there are 2 'portal.load' events that you should try to combine into 1 to see if that helps.  And the 'addLayer' functions are just that, functions that need to be called, not events.  If you are trying to get a reference to when the layer gets added, you may try something like:

// This function fires each time a layer view is created for a layer in
// the map of the view.
view.on("layerview-create", function(event) {
  // The event contains the layer and its layer view that has just been
  // created. Here we check for the creation of a layer view for a layer with
  // a specific id, and log the layer view
  if (event.layer.id === "satellite") {
    // The LayerView for the desired layer
    console.log(event.layerView);
  }
});

But I don't really see anywhere that a layer is being added.

If the item being reference is a layer, you might try getting it as a PortalItem and then adding it to the map, as in:

// to access the portal item at this url
// http://www.arcgis.com/home/item.html?id=d7892b3c13b44391992ecd42bfa92d01
var item = new PortalItem({
  id: "d7892b3c13b44391992ecd42bfa92d01"
});
if (item.isLayer) {
  Layer.fromPortalItem({
    portalItem: item
  }).then(addLayerToMap);
}
